So, they pulled a TSB and went through all the steps which included six things. They also added an extra ground from the starter to the frame. If it doesn't fix the issue they will do the master switch. I ordered one online and will switch it myself. $50 shipped was fair.

 

As far as the camera situation goes, the programmer said we'd have to lower the camera in the grill 4.5" because of my lift kit. It wouldn't let him do anything. Something about GM cameras don't allow you to prvogram the angle like Dodge and Ford do.

    • Sierra HD Pro:   - If you want a power driver's seat on the Pro, you can't get it.  You have to go to SLE.   - Factory remote start?  Can't get it on any of the Sierra Pro trim (1500 or HD).  You have to go SLE.     - 7 inch radio has limitations for replacement if you wanted to upgrade the screen, etc.    - Steering wheel radio controls?  Nope.  Can you add them?  Yes.  NOT CHEAP.  Requires a new instrument cluster, steering wheel and wiring harness mod kit.     - Fog lights?  Nope.  And no factory path to install them.    Sierra HD SLE:   - IMO, the larger radio screen is a much better interface.   - Fog lights?  You can get them.  Steering wheel controls?  Has them.  Remote start?  Yep.  Power driver seat?  Available.       Silverado WT:   - Same as the Pro above however you CAN get factory remote start installed at the dealer for the WT Chevy.     Silverado Custom:   - Comes with 20" wheels only.  Can you swap later?  Sure.  But.  Truck is calibrated for the stock 20s (34" tire) and no path to properly recalibrate.     - Power seat?  Yes.   - Steering wheel controls?  Same as the Pro above.  No but can be done and not cheap.     Silverado LT:   - Same as the SLE.  You can get or it comes with many features you can't do on the lower trims.       I'd say its all going to come down to what you NEED and what you WANT to have that you'd benefit from.  For me, things like power seat is a must (I hate the WT/Pro seating position), so I'd have to go Custom, LT or SLE right out of the gate.  Steering wheel controls?  Should be standard in 2026 across the board IMO, so again, puts me to LT or SLE.

    • Modifications are required.  2020-2023 the wheel well sheet metal does not have all of the fastener openings stamped for liners that the 2024-2026 dually wells have.  The liners are the right shape and everything, and the wheel well sheet metal is the same shape, its just the older trucks don't have all of the mounting points.     Here's a link to a Facebook post about doing this - https://www.facebook.com/share/p/1Nqow8VNKE/
